Transaction 96dfa5a89d1684b2dc3c9fca03782475650dafa1432d53833edfc10f0a19a305
1 Input
1 Output
-
96dfa5a89d1684b2dc3c9fca03782475650dafa1432d53833edfc10f0a19a305:0
- value
- 15885
- script pubkey
- OP_0 OP_PUSHBYTES_20 86a2cb1d446c49ecf54c6ebdde1a5b20afc13f7f
- address
- bc1qs63vk82yd3y7ea2vd67auxjmyzhuz0mlrg0v2k